The ICS8343I is a low skew, 1-to-16 Fanout
Buffer and a member of the HiPerClockS™ family
of High Performance Clock Solutions from ICS.

FEATURES
• 16 L VCMOS outputs
• Output frequency up to 200MHz
• 250ps output skew
•· 700ps part to part
• CMOS compatible clock input at 5V , L VTTL and LVCMOS
compatible at 3.3V and 2.5V
• L VTTL output enable inputs
• Dual output enable inputs facilitates 1-to-16 or 1-to-8 input to
output modes
• 5.0V , 3.3V , 2.5V or mixed 3.3V , 2.5V from -40°C to 85°C
ambient operating temperature
• 32 lead low-profile QFP(LQFP), 7mm x 7mm x 1.4mm
package body , 0.8mm package lead pitch

ABSOLUTE MAXIMUM RATINGS
Supply Voltage7V
Inputs-0.5V to VDD+0.5 V
Outputs-0.5V to VDD+0.5V
Ambient Operating T emperature -40°C to 85°C
Storage T emperature-65°C to 150°C
